Research Interests:
The goal of the present research effort is to provideincreased understanding of and quantitative
information about the mechanism ofpolymer induced
turbulent drag reduction._ To realize this goal, aquantification of flow transitions using well
characterized dilutepolymer solutions is studied in
flow generated between concentric, rotatingcylinders:
Taylor-Couette (TC) flow. (Figure 1)
